I have received a Parking Charge Notice for "Parking Outside of Tram Service Hours" at Metrolink Whitefield on 2/11/14 at 05:17. This was from Care Parking (where do they get these names from???!!!!).

I have used this car park many times to park overnight after using the Metrolink. It is a free car park and you don't need to display a ticket. Recently they have built a new car park and I have obviously not picked up on the change in parking rules.

I used the Metrolink park and ride and collected my car the morning after and had the lovely surprise of a charge of £100, reduced to £60 if paid within 14 days.

I am completely disgusted in this massive charge for what is a free car park, and considering I had bought and paid for a Metrolink ticket using their park and ride.

I have been looking at the forums on here and looked at the **NEWBIES!! PRIVATE PARKING TICKET? OLD OR NEW? **READ THESE FAQS FIRST!**

I am a little confused though, should I wait to receive the Notice To Keeper in the post and then appeal with the PPC then get the likely rejection (and then appeal to POPLA). OR should I appeal now before receiving the Notice To Keeper?Any help really appreciated.

    You cannot be confused. The Newbies Sticky makes it quite clear you wait for the NTK. Why give them your personal details for free and lose an opportunity for them to maybe screw-up the process in your favour by getting the timescale wrong?

The signage is extremely misleading as you drive into the carpark, stating 'Free Parking for Metrolink passengers' and then 'this carpark is for the use of Metrolink passengers only', but then on other signs in MUCH smaller letters (unreadable from the car) has all the conditions and exceptions. And yes the driver has parked here overnight many times but not since the carpark was redeveloped.
